Exactly How Pet Dog Day Care Assists Separation Anxiousness
Pet dogs with separation anxiousness display a range of actions consisting of whimpering and eating when their owners leave. Canine daycare provides a secure and interesting atmosphere that can help in reducing these signs.
Usually, canines that come home to chewed-up furnishings or non-stop barking are experiencing splitting up anxiety. While day care can aid take care of the symptoms, it is not an option for all dogs with separation anxiousness.
Socialization
Socialization is an effective device to help treat splitting up anxiousness. It teaches canines to rely on various other humans in an atmosphere where they can be securely separated from their owners. This can make veterinarian brows through, grooming appointments, and various other human communications less stressful.
Pet dogs that are not mingled might display damaging actions or too much barking when left alone. These behaviors can be triggered by dullness, stress, or lack of exercise. Throughout childcare, your pet will participate in team play and exercise, which helps them burn pent-up energy. The structured activities and regimen of childcare additionally prevents boredom, which can be a trigger for separation stress and anxiety.
Participating in childcare routinely likewise develops a regular and knowledge for your pet, making them view being away from their owner as typical. While pet dog childcare does not heal splitting up anxiety on its own, it can offer considerable benefits to your puppy along with various other therapy alternatives (behavior training and desensitization).
Excitement
Several dogs with separation anxiety feel a sense of abandonment when they're left alone. This typically materializes as extreme barking, chewing on furniture, and attempts to get away.
Pet dogs in childcare are offered plenty of physical and mental stimulation. When pet moms and dads hand over their dogs, they are divided right into play teams according to age and task degree. This permits a secure setting for every person. After that comes early morning team play, a time when pet dogs can involve with their fellow day care friends and burn excess energy. After a long day of playing and snacking, it's nap time.
For numerous canines, a consistent routine of attending daycare a few times a week aids relieve splitting up anxiousness. Once they find out that being far from home isn't a big deal, they will certainly be less nervous when their owners are away for work or vacationing. They'll additionally return worn out, so they'll be a lot more able to relax with the night without stressing over their owner.

Training
Pet dogs typically develop splitting up anxiety when there's an adjustment in routine. This can be caused by relocating houses, transforming jobs, or perhaps a new enhancement to the household (a baby or a pup). Canines that experience separation anxiousness will reveal signs like too much chewing, barking, and home soiling.
A regular schedule of day-to-day social interaction via daycare can aid canines conquer their anxiety concerning being alone. This is achieved via a gradual strategy that exposes the pet to longer periods of time without their proprietors.
Training sessions with daycare can likewise help with splitting up anxiousness. The mental excitement provided via obedience and agility tasks keeps pet dogs inhabited, so they don't concentrate on their anxieties. Enrichment video games and scent work take advantage of a dog's natural searching instincts and are a reliable way to minimize dullness that results in anxiety-related actions. Ultimately, while childcare can be helpful in the short term, it's not a treatment for separation stress and anxiety. Rather, a professional behaviorist must be consulted to produce a thorough separation stress and anxiety therapy plan that consists of training, desensitization, and favorable reinforcement.
